Week #8 Battle of Titians

Okay maybe calling this match-up the battle of the titans is a bit too much hype. But the Week #8 meeting between the Philly Hitmen (6-1) and Rando's Razors could be a post season preview. Both teams lead their divisions. Its the second week in a row the Hitmen face a division leader. Last week they suffered their first loss to the PitBulls (a perennial juggernaut).


The Hitmen have a better shot this week, because the Razors are a bit of a paper tiger. The Hitmen are a 1 point favorite, but the Razors are notorious for under achieving. Their 6-1 record is the result of a weak division and some frickin' luck.

Key Match-ups: The Hitmen's QB Drew Brees must shake off jet lag after a flight to London, England for a game against the Chargers. The Razors' Donovan McNabb comes off a BYE week to face the Atlanta Falcons. Uhmm ... Donnie is that Falcon meat in your chunky soup?

Projected Winner: Philly Hitmen

In other match-ups; Romo's Raiders (5-2) vs Jesse's Tap Out (4-3) matches two contenders who trail their division leaders by 1 game. But the Raiders are trying to keep their boat afloat after the loss of Reggie Bush (Bush averaged 15 points per game). The rookie Tap Out is a heavy favorite (+20). But he is a rookie.

The Jonesville Terrapins (1-6) are favored to win their second straight over the Tigers (2-5) who are in a tailspin. The Terps' recent trade for Willis McGahee could be a key to this match-up.
